Getting There

  • Bus

    From downtown Milwaukee, walk to the nearest bus stop and take the Milwaukee County Transit System bus #10 heading westbound. Stay on the bus for about 20 minutes and get off at the stop at Wauwatosa Ave & 21st St. From there, walk north on Wauwatosa Ave for about 5 minutes until you reach the Lowell Damon House at 2107 N Wauwatosa Ave.

  • Bicycle

    Rent a bike from one of the bike-sharing services available in Milwaukee. Start at a downtown location and head west on the Hank Aaron State Trail. Follow the trail until you reach Wauwatosa Ave. Turn left on Wauwatosa Ave and continue biking for approximately 3 miles. The Lowell Damon House will be on your right at 2107 N Wauwatosa Ave.

  • Walking

    If you are near the Milwaukee Public Market, start walking northwest on N Broadway St. Continue on Broadway as it turns into N 1st St. Cross over the Milwaukee River and continue straight as it becomes W Wells St. After about 1.5 miles, turn left onto N Wauwatosa Ave and walk for another 0.5 miles. The Lowell Damon House will be on your left at 2107 N Wauwatosa Ave.

  • Rideshare

    Use a rideshare app like Uber or Lyft. Enter the destination as '2107 N Wauwatosa Ave, Wauwatosa, WI 53213' in the app. The pickup location can be anywhere in Milwaukee, and the driver will take you directly to the Lowell Damon House.
